OTTAWA—Conservative Sen. Denise Batters has been excluded from all Senate committees after challenging Erin O’Toole’s leadership. O’Toole booted the Saskatchewan senator out of the Conservative national caucus last month after she launched a petition aimed at forcing a referendum on his leadership within six months−rather than wait for a scheduled confidence vote at the party’s convention in August 2023. Conservative senators have chosen to keep Batters in their fold, notwithstanding O’Toole’s warning that anyone backing her petition would be kicked out of caucus. Now, however, she has been conspicuously left out of any committee assignments in the upper house. Sen. Leo Housakos, acting leader of the Conservative Senate caucus, has not responded to a request to explain Batters’ exclusion. Batters declined to comment.
